Kecerdasan Buatan (AI) bukan lagi sekadar fiksyen sains. Ia kini mengubah landskap pembangunan web dengan pantas. Soalan sejuta dolar: Adakah AI akan menggantikan pembangun web sepenuhnya?
Jawapannya: Tidak. Tapi AI akan menggantikan pembangun yang tidak tahu menggunakan AI. Mari kita lihat bagaimana teknologi ini mengubah industri kita.
Revolusi Diam-Diam Yang Sedang Berlaku
GitHub melaporkan bahawa 46% daripada kod yang ditulis pada tahun 2025 dihasilkan dengan bantuan AI. Ini bukan lagi futuristik — ini adalah realiti hari ini.
Tools seperti GitHub Copilot, ChatGPT, Claude, dan ramai lagi sedang mengubah cara developer bekerja. Dari yang dulunya ambil 3 jam untuk setup boilerplate, kini hanya ambil 5 minit.
"AI tidak akan menggantikan pembangun web, tetapi pembangun web yang menggunakan AI akan menggantikan mereka yang tidak menggunakannya."
5 Cara AI Mengubah Web Development
1. Code Generation & Autocomplete
AI kini boleh menulis function lengkap berdasarkan komen atau context anda. Bayangkan anda taip:
Dan AI terus generate full implementation dengan error handling, regex validation, dan domain verification. Magic? Bukan. Teknologi.
2. Bug Detection & Fixing
Dulu kita debug pakai console.log 50 kali. Sekarang? AI boleh scan kod, kenal pasti potential bugs, dan suggest fix.
Ia bukan sekadar syntax error — AI boleh detect logical errors, security vulnerabilities, dan performance bottlenecks.
3. Documentation Generation
Siapa suka tulis documentation? Senyap.
AI boleh auto-generate docs dari kod anda. Comments, API references, usage examples — semua automated. Developer focus pada kod, AI handle paperwork.
4. Testing Automation
Unit tests adalah penting. Tapi boring nak tulis. AI boleh:
- Generate test cases based on your functions
- Create edge case scenarios you might miss
- Write integration tests automatically
- Suggest test coverage improvements
5. Personalization Engine
Website masa depan bukan static. Ia adaptive. AI boleh real-time adjust content, layout, dan CTA based on user behavior. Ini bukan A/B testing — ini adalah individualized experiences.
Apa Yang AI Tidak Boleh Buat (Lagi)
AI sangat powerful, tapi ia ada limitasi:
- ❌ Memahami Business Logic Yang Kompleks — AI tidak tahu bisnes flow anda yang unique
- ❌ Creative Problem Solving — AI suggest solutions, tapi humans yang decide best approach
- ❌ Client Communication — AI tak boleh duduk meeting dengan client untuk faham requirements
- ❌ Contextual Decision Making — Trade-offs antara speed vs security vs cost require human judgment
Bagaimana Developer Perlu Adapt?
1. Learn to Prompt Effectively
Skill baru yang diperlukan: prompt engineering. Tahu cara communicate dengan AI untuk dapat hasil terbaik.
2. Focus on Architecture
AI boleh tulis kod, tapi ia tak design system architecture. High-level thinking akan jadi lebih valuable.
3. Master Human Skills
Communication, empathy, creativity — skills yang AI susah nak replicate. Double down on these.
Tools Yang Wajib Cuba
- GitHub Copilot — AI pair programmer
- ChatGPT/Claude — Debugging assistant & code explainer
- v0.dev — AI-powered UI generation
- Cursor AI — IDE dengan AI built-in
Kesimpulan
AI dalam web development bukan ancaman — ia adalah leverage. Developer yang embrace AI akan 10x lebih productive dari yang tidak.
Masa depan bukan tentang manusia vs AI. Ia tentang manusia + AI. Collaboration, bukan competition.
Nak Website Yang Leverage AI Technology?
Kami build web applications menggunakan latest AI tools untuk deliver faster, better, dan lebih intelligent solutions.
Bincang Projek Anda →